Where to Use Carefully
While Bathika is versatile, it should be used with care in certain contexts. Large headlines may risk looking too decorative, so it’s better suited for short phrases or brand marks. Social posts benefit from its charm, but it should be paired with a readable body font to maintain legibility. Supporting text should never be in Bathika, as it can become difficult to read at small sizes.
When designing merchandise or printable products, test Bathika against different backgrounds and materials. It looks great on glossy finishes but may lose some of its character on matte surfaces. Always confirm commercial licensing before using it in client work or business assets.
Readability and Hierarchy
Bathika’s readability is one of its strongest points. Even in black and white, it maintains a clear structure, making it suitable for a variety of print and digital applications. However, it’s important to test it in small sizes, especially for body text. While it reads well at larger sizes, it can become less legible when scaled down.
For hierarchy, use Bathika for emphasis rather than for long blocks of text. Pair it with a clean sans serif or serif font for contrast. A good pairing could be a modern sans serif for body text and Bathika for headings or callouts. This balance ensures that the design remains professional while still allowing the script to shine.
